开关机测试系统及方法

文档序号:6336448阅读:627来源:国知局
专利名称:开关机测试系统及方法
技术领域
本发明涉及一种开关机测试系统及方法。
背景技术
开关机(ON-OFF)测试是检验待测设备性能情况的一项重要测试,目前主要都是测试人员进行手动测试,这样容易导致无法知道什么时候会开机或关机失败,也无法随时使用三用电表量测电压来判断是否有开机成功。此外,一般情况下,待测设备的 SPEC (Standard Performance Evaluation Corporation,系统性能评估测试)都要求 0N-0FF—千次、一万次,导致测试费时费力,且由于人为因素,容易出错。同时由于使用固定的开机与关机时间来对待测设备进行开关机测试,无法准确全面的了解待测设备在何时开机或关机失败。

发明内容
鉴于以上内容,有必要提供一种开关机测试方法,通过自动化的测试方式,以及随机选择开机与关机时间对待测电源装置进行测试,准确全面的进行开关机测试。此外,还有必要提供一种开关机测试系统,通过自动化的测试方式,以及随机选择开机与关机时间对待测电源装置进行测试,准确全面的进行开关机测试。一种开关机测试方法,应用于计算机中,所述的计算机通过通用接口总线GPIB分别与直流电子负载、电源供应装置以及电压量测装置相连接,所述的直流电子负载、电源供应装置以及电压量测装置均与待测电源装置相连接。该方法包括设置步骤预设为待测电源装置提供的负载与电压、测试次数、开机与关机时间的范围以及初始化已测试次数为零;控制步骤在开机与关机时间的范围中随机选择一个数字作为开机与关机时间,以及控制已测试次数加一;开机步骤根据所述设置的负载与电压以及所选择的开机时间,控制所述的待测电源装置开机,并持续所选择的开机时间;读取步骤在持续开机时间内实时控制电压量测装置量测所述待测电源装置的工作电压值,并读取量测到的工作电压值; 关机步骤当待测电源装置开机持续了所选择的开机时间,且所读取的工作电压值不为零时,控制所述的待测电源装置关机,并持续所选择的关机时间。一种开关机测试系统,运行于计算机中,所述的计算机通过通用接口总线GPIB分别与直流电子负载、电源供应装置以及电压量测装置相连接,所述的直流电子负载、电源供应装置以及电压量测装置均与待测电源装置相连接。该系统包括设置模块,用于预设为待测电源装置提供的负载与电压,并预设测试次数,开机与关机时间的范围,以及初始化已测试次数为零;控制模块,用于在开机与关机时间的范围中随机选择一个数字作为开机与关机时间,以及控制已测试次数加一;所述的控制模块,还用于根据所述设置的负载与电压以及所选择的开机时间,控制所述的待测电源装置开机,并持续所选择的开机时间;所述的控制模块,还用于在持续开机时间内控制电压量测装置实时量测所述待测电源装置的工作电压值,并读取量测到的工作电压值;所述的控制模块,还用于当待测电源装置开机持续了所选择的开机时间,且所读取的工作电压值不为零时,控制所述的待测电源装置关机,并持续所选择的关机时间。相较于现有技术,本发明所述的开关机测试系统及方法,通过自动化的测试方式, 以及随机选择开机与关机时间对待测电源装置进行测试,准确全面的进行开关机测试,提高了测试效率。此外,当测试待测电源装置的开机性能时,如果开机失败,则自动关闭电源供应装置以及直流电子负载,结束测试流程,这样可以准确了解在何时开机或关机失败。


图1是本发明开关机测试系统较佳实施例的架构示意图。图2是本发明开关机测试系统较佳实施例的功能模块图。图3是本发明开关机测试方法较佳实施例的流程图。主要元件符号说明
权利要求
1.一种开关机测试方法,应用于计算机中,所述的计算机通过通用接口总线GPIB分别与直流电子负载、电源供应装置以及电压量测装置相连接,所述的直流电子负载、电源供应装置以及电压量测装置均与待测电源装置相连接,其特征在于,该方法包括设置步骤预设为待测电源装置提供的负载与电压、测试次数、开机与关机时间的范围以及初始化已测试次数为零;控制步骤在开机与关机时间的范围中随机选择一个数字作为开机与关机时间,以及控制已测试次数加一;开机步骤根据所述设置的负载与电压以及所选择的开机时间,控制所述的待测电源装置开机,并持续所选择的开机时间;读取步骤在持续开机时间内实时控制电压量测装置量测所述待测电源装置的工作电压值,并读取量测到的工作电压值;关机步骤当待测电源装置开机持续了所选择的开机时间,且所读取的工作电压值不为零时,控制所述的待测电源装置关机,并持续所选择的关机时间。
2.如权利要求1所述的开关机测试方法,其特征在于,该方法还包括显示步骤在计算机的显示单元上显示上述的已测试次数与此次所选择的开机与关机时间。
3.如权利要求1所述的开关机测试方法,其特征在于,所述的开机步骤是通过GPIB控制直流电子负载为待测电源装置提供设置的负载,控制电源供应装置为待测电源装置提供所设置的电压,并持续所选择的开机时间来实现的;以及所述的关机步骤是通过GPIB控制直流电子负载为待测电源装置提供的负载为零,控制电源供应装置为待测电源装置提供的电压为零,从而关闭直流电子负载与电源供应装置,并持续所选择的关机时间来实现的。
4.如权利要求3所述的开关机测试方法,其特征在于,该方法还包括步骤在待测电源装置持续开机的过程中,当所读取的工作电压为零时,关闭所述的直流电子负载与电源供应装置,并记录此次测试结果为测试失败,结束流程;以及在待测电源装置持续关机的过程中,当所读取的工作电压值不为零时,记录此次测试结果为测试失败,结束流程。
5.如权利要求1所述的开关机测试方法,其特征在于,该方法还包括当待测电源装置关机持续了所选择的关机时间,且所读取的工作电压值为零时,记录此次测试结果为测试成功,并判断已测试次数是否达到所设置的测试次数;及若已测试次数达到所设置的测试次数,则流程结束;或若已测试次数没有达到所设置的测试次数,则返回控制步骤,继续下一次测试。
6.一种开关机测试系统,运行于计算机中,所述的计算机通过通用接口总线GPIB分别与直流电子负载、电源供应装置以及电压量测装置相连接,所述的直流电子负载、电源供应装置以及电压量测装置均与待测电源装置相连接,其特征在于,该系统包括设置模块,用于预设为待测电源装置提供的负载与电压,并预设测试次数,开机与关机时间的范围,以及初始化已测试次数为零;控制模块,用于在开机与关机时间的范围中随机选择一个数字作为开机与关机时间, 以及控制已测试次数加一;所述的控制模块,还用于根据所述设置的负载与电压以及所选择的开机时间,控制所述的待测电源装置开机,并持续所选择的开机时间;所述的控制模块,还用于在持续开机时间内控制电压量测装置实时量测所述待测电源装置的工作电压值,并读取量测到的工作电压值;所述的控制模块,还用于当待测电源装置开机持续了所选择的开机时间,且所读取的工作电压值不为零时,控制所述的待测电源装置关机,并持续所选择的关机时间。
7.如权利要求6所述的开关机测试系统,其特征在于,该系统还包括显示模块,用于在计算机的显示单元上显示上述的已测试次数与此次所选择的开机与关机时间。
8.如权利要求6所述的开关机测试系统,其特征在于,所述的控制模块是通过GPIB控制直流电子负载为待测电源装置提供设置的负载,控制电源供应装置为待测电源装置提供所设置的电压,并持续所选择的开机时间,来控制待测电源装置开机以及持续所选择的开机时间;以及通过GPIB控制直流电子负载为待测电源装置提供的负载为零,控制电源供应装置为待测电源装置提供的电压为零,从而关闭直流电子负载与电源供应装置,并持续所选择的关机时间,来控制待测电源装置关机以及持续所选择的关机时间。
9.如权利要求8所述的开关机测试系统,其特征在于,所述的控制模块还用于在待测电源装置持续开机的过程中,当所读取的工作电压为零时,关闭所述的直流电子负载与电源供应装置,结束开关机测试流程。
10.如权利要求6所述的开关机测试系统,其特征在于,该系统还包括记录模块,用于在待测电源装置持续开机的过程中,当所读取的工作电压为零,或在待测电源装置持续关机的过程中,当所读取的工作电压不为零时,记录此次测试结果为测试失败,以及当待测电源装置关机持续了所选择的关机时间,且在该持续关机时间内所读取的工作电压值为零时记录此次结果为测试成功;判断模块,用于当记录此次测试结果为测试成功时,判断已测试次数是否达到所设置的测试次数,若没有达到所设置的测试次数,则继续下一次测试,若达到所设置的测试次数,则开关机测试结束。
全文摘要
一种开关机测试系统及方法,该方法包括预设开机与关机时间的范围、测试次数以及初始化已测试次数;在开机与关机时间的范围中随机选择一个数字作为开机与关机时间,以及控制已测试次数加一;控制所述的待测电源装置开机,并持续所选择的开机时间;在持续开机时间内实时控制电压量测装置量测所述待测电源装置的工作电压值,并读取量测到的工作电压值;当待测电源装置开机持续了所选择的开机时间,且所读取的工作电压值不为零时,控制所述的待测电源装置关机,并持续所选择的关机时间。利用本发明能够更加自动化以及有效的进行开关机测试。
文档编号G06F11/22GK102479120SQ20101055321
公开日2012年5月30日 申请日期2010年11月22日 优先权日2010年11月22日
发明者李伟铭 申请人:鸿富锦精密工业(深圳)有限公司, 鸿海精密工业股份有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1